Products Description

The YNJX250 Planetary Clamping Bucking Unit is a professional hydraulic bucking machine designed for precision make-up and break-out of oilfield tubing, casing, and downhole tools. It supports pipe O.D. 60–140mm (2‑3/8" to 5‑1/2") with a wide gripping range of Ø60–Ø230mm without requiring die changes, and delivers a maximum torque of 20 kN·m (14,751 ft·lb) at 20MPa. Equipped with Siemens S7‑1200 PLC and 15" industrial computer, it ensures accurate torque and turns monitoring, automatic operation, and stable performance. Adopting three-point synchronous planetary clamping structure, this tubing casing bucking machine provides reliable, non-slip gripping without damaging threads, widely used in oilfield downhole tool assembly, production and repair lines.

I. YNJX250 Planetary Clamping Bucking Unit Structures and Features

The YNJX250/68 bucking machine is primarily used in oilfields for make-up and break-out operations of downhole tools, threaded connections, casing, drill pipes, tubing, and other threaded components during manufacturing, assembly, and maintenance. It features high torque and smooth transmission.


YNJX-250/68 High-Torque Hydraulic Bucking Machine

The YNJX-250/68 hydraulic bucking machine features a split-structure design, specifically developed for assembling and disassembling various downhole tools in oilfields, such as different types of packers and jar tools. The design allows operators to conveniently operate the equipment on the machine bed platform. The hydraulic power unit is separated from the main body, making it easier to clean the oil tank, reduce noise, and improve oil cooling efficiency. The cooling system adopts an air-cooled cooler.


Power Tong Assembly
1) The power tong is used to grip and rotate the coupling for make-up and break-out operations. It is driven by a hydraulic motor through a speed-changing mechanism and gear transmission, which rotates the internal ring gear. This in turn drives the planetary gears, which activate the planetary clamping arms. The three planetary arms clamp the pipe simultaneously, ensuring strong, reliable grip without slippage.
2) The clamping range is wide (Ø60 mm to Ø230 mm) and does not require jaw/dies replacement within this range.
3) Given the high torque output of this model, reinforced gears are used in the design and manufacturing to enhance strength and ensure long-term reliability.
4) The power tong features a band-type brake system, known for its long service life, easy maintenance, low consumption, and cost-efficiency.


Backup Tong Assembly
1) The backup tong grips the pipe body during make-up and break-out operations to prevent rotation. It uses a pneumatic or hydraulic cylinder-driven clamping mechanism, providing secure and reliable grip.
2) The backup tong is mounted on a trolley that moves along the machine bed via chain drive for easy adjustment.
3) Equipped with a floating clamping structure and a tension sensor for torque measurement, the sensor transmits data to an industrial computer, which displays real-time torque readings during operations.
4) The system uses a PLC + IPC (Industrial PC) control system for automated operation. It can display real-time torque, historical curves, data logs, and parameter settings. It also supports printing and saving of daily/monthly reports and torque curve graphs.
